    I still don't get what the Vulture connection was for, I don't think Miles has ever even met him. Was it just an MCU thing?
    Yeah. Tiana is pretty much an adaptation of MCU Liz (whose last name is Allan in the comics, but presumably Toomes in the movie - they never gave her surname). Barbara was based on Zendaya's MJ, and there's a character based on MCU Flash Thompson too, though he quickly fell by the wayside. Of course, Miles already had a Ned, as MCU Ned is based on Ganke Lee in the first place (though the second film did give him a story based on comics Ned by having him date Betty Brant).

    Barbara does not predate Civil War. She debuted in Spider-Men II #1 in July 2017, the same month Spider-Man Homecoming was released. Civil War was April 2016.
